I have a yellow dog, a full black coyote skin, a red fox and a grey fox skin curing out and want to make a quiver from one of them. I am looking for pics or plans to make one but my searches are not finding what I want. Thought you all could help with a link or pics to some. I really like the plains style with quiver and bow sock combined but would be interested in any style.

That dark coyote sounds really nice! Grey fox are pretty small, as I'm sure you know. It may limit your work, possibly the red fox may limit you too unless its a decent size. Coyotes give you plenty to work with. I make back quivers out of all of them but dont have any photos of plains style. Some guys here made some really nice ones though, you'll get a ton of pics.  What do you have for leather for the interior and straps?
